B 88, 144507 (2013)", "doi": "10.1103/PhysRevB.88.144507", "categories": [ "cond-mat.mes-hall" ], "abstract": "We consider microwave spectroscopy of Josephon junctions composed of hybridized Majorana states in topological 1-D superconductors. We point out how spectroscopic features of the junction appear in the current phase relation under microwave irradiation. Moreover, we discuss a way to directly probe the nonequilibrium state associated with the 4{\\pi} periodic Josephson effect. In particular, we show how the microwave driving can be used to switch from a 4{\\pi} to a 2{\\pi} Shapiro step in the current voltage relation.", "revisions": [ { "version": "v1", "updated": "2013-03-10T18:06:58.000Z" } ], "analyses": { "subjects": [ "74.45.+c", "71.10.Pm", "73.23.-b" ], "keywords": [ "microwave spectroscopy", "josephson junctions", "topological superconductors", "current voltage relation", "periodic josephson effect" ], "tags": [ "journal article" ], "publication": { "publisher": "APS", "journal": "Physical Review B", "year": 2013, "month": "Oct", "volume": 88, "number": 14, "pages": 144507 }, "note": { "typesetting": "TeX", "pages": 8, "language": "en", "license": "arXiv", "status": "editable", "adsabs": "2013PhRvB..88n4507V" } } }
